After checking out the room I ran downstairs to Exhale, the hotel’s spa. I was there for some relaxation, but Exhale offers everything from massages to facials to fitness classes and more. *And a bonus for all you Atlantans– Exhale is not exclusive to Loews guests so you can book a spa appointment or fitness class any time!

Saltwood is the restaurant downstairs at the Loews Hotel. It features incredible drinks, locally sourced meats and cheeses and delicious shared plates. We ordered the flatbread of the day (which happened to be peaches, goat cheese and mushrooms!!), the Saltwood board and the southern paella. And every last bite was delicious! Oh and if you’re looking for a great cocktail, be sure to order the “summer break!” It was my favorite.
